How to prepare for a job interview at One Retail

Know Your Ingredients

Familiarise yourself with the types of ingredients and dishes that are popular in healthcare settings. Be ready to discuss how you can create nutritious yet delicious meals that cater to various dietary needs.

Showcase Your Passion

During the interview, let your enthusiasm for cooking shine through. Share stories about your culinary journey and what inspires you to create exceptional food experiences, especially in a healthcare environment.

Demonstrate Team Spirit

Highlight your ability to work well in a team. Discuss past experiences where collaboration was key to success, as working in a kitchen requires strong communication and teamwork skills.

Prepare for Practical Questions

Expect questions about food safety, meal preparation techniques, and how you handle challenges in the kitchen. Brush up on your knowledge and be ready to provide specific examples from your experience.
